Remember that over 90% of mobile users read their text messages within three (3) minutes of receiving the message. So you need to have a provider that can deliver SMS to your customers promptly but most providers should be able to send SMS within 15 seconds, via a reliable premium telecommunication gateway network that can handle large volumes of SMS.

There are two types of carrier gateways known as Direct and Hybrid. Direct uses Australian telecommunication carriers such as Telstra, Optus or Vodafone but these are usually more expensive. Hybrid gateway uses overseas telecommunication carriers which are cheaper but less reliable.

Reliability of SMS Marketing Providers

Reliability is an issue that always needs to be asked. You do not want delays and duplicate issues to impair the marketing campaign. One of the issues alerted before is the type of gateway carrier used. Australian telcos are much more reliable and direct connections to one of these carriers will provide better reassurance that the message will be sent.
